Abstract
The invention discloses a piglet compound premix composition which comprises the following raw materials in parts by mass: 0.04-0.05 part of zinc glycinate, 0.1-0.2 part of ferrous fumarate, 0.01-0.015 part of yeast selenium, 0.1-0.15 part of ethoxyquinoline, 0.1-0.3 part of yeast chromium, 0.05-0.1 part of lysine zinc, 10-25 parts of calcium hydrophosphate, 40-60 parts of zeolite powder and 10-20 parts of calcium carbonate; the piglet compound premix comprises the following components in percentage by weight based on the finally prepared 1Kg of piglet compound premix composition: v of 240-300IUE800-900mg of VB2500-600mg of VB12350-400mg of VB6. The composition of the piglet compound premix is applied to feed ration, can enhance the appetite of piglets and promote the growth and the tissue regeneration of organisms; by accelerating the utilization of glucose in vivo and promoting the metabolism and growth and development of protein, the effects of increasing the feed intake and fully digesting, absorbing and utilizing the nutrient substances in the feed are achieved; by participating in the immune function process, the immunity mechanism can be enhanced, the resistance can be improved, and the external stress can be effectively resisted.
Description
Technical field
The present invention relates to a kind of composition of composite pre-mixed fodder for piglets.
Background technology
The child care piglet is a maximum stage of the speed of growth in the pig growth course, guarantee the healthy growth at a high speed of child care piglet, needs higher energy and protein level, and this just requires to improve the feed intake of piglet, and can digest and assimilate fully.Present product be mostly through add phagostimulant, flavouring agent improves the feed intake of piglet, is exactly eat too many of piglet and can not digest and cause the piglet trophism diarrhea but a problem occurs through regular meeting.
Summary of the invention
The composition that the purpose of this invention is to provide a kind of composite pre-mixed fodder for piglets.
The technical scheme that the present invention taked is:
A kind of composition of composite pre-mixed fodder for piglets comprises the raw material of following mass parts: the lysine-zn of the ethoxyquinoline of the ferrous fumarate of the glycine zine of 0.04-0.05 part, 0.1-0.2 part, the yeast selenium of 0.01-0.015 part, 0.1-0.15 part, the yeast chromium of 0.1-0.3 part, 0.05-0.1 part, the calcium monohydrogen phosphate of 10-25 part, the zeolite powder of 40-60 part, the calcium carbonate of 10-20 part; According to the composition meter of the composite pre-mixed fodder for piglets of the 1Kg that is mixed with at last, also comprise the V of following component: 240-300IU
E, 800-900mg V
B2, 500-600mg V
B12, 350-400mg V
B6
Described zeolite powder is the 60-500 order.
The order number of described calcium monohydrogen phosphate is the 20-40 order.
The invention has the beneficial effects as follows: the composition of composite pre-mixed fodder for piglets of the present invention is applied in the feed diet, can strengthen piglet appetite, promotes growing and regeneration of body; Through accelerating the utilization of glucose in the body, promote protein metabolism and grow, reach the effect that can digest, absorb, utilize nutriment in the feed when increasing feed intake again fully; Through participating in the immunologic function process, can enhance immunity mechanism, improve resistance, being highly resistant to the external world stress.Simultaneously, promote the piglet skeletal growth to grow, for its later stage high-speed rapid growth is laid a good foundation.

Test portion:
1 material and method
1.1 experimental animal and grouping
The selective body heavy phase is near, the good wean of health status after 10 days 160 of left and right sides piglets be divided into 2 groups at random, the I group is control group, totally 81, is divided into 3 groups.The II group is a test group, totally 79, is divided into 3 groups.
1.2 test period
From on September 23,2011 13 days to 2011 August in, totally 41 days.
1.3 feeding period daily ration and management
Adopt unified feed formula, test group is on the daily ration basis of control group, and complete diet pellet per ton adds the auxin of 2kg.Before the test the various utensils that supply the examination piglet to use are carried out thorough disinfection, at duration of test, free choice feeding and drinking-water, other immunity, sterilization and management are undertaken by the daily feeding and management standard in pig farm.
The prescription of the daily ration of control group consists of: corn 52 mass parts, dregs of beans 13 mass parts, popcorn 11.5 mass parts, expanded soybean 6 mass parts, fermented bean dregs 4 mass parts, fish meal 4 mass parts, stone flour 1 mass parts, calcium monohydrogen phosphate 1.5 mass parts, palm oil 1.2 mass parts, sucrose 3.8 mass parts.
1.4 method
When on-test and off-test every hurdle test piggy is carried out empty stomach and weigh, the total feed consumption rate of record calculates average daily gain, feedstuff-meat ratio, the incidence of disease in the process of the test.Pig is weighed when then dead if death is arranged, and writes down its last weight.Duration of test is observed the searching for food of swinery, drinking-water situation every day and is had or not abnormal conditions such as diarrhoea, and carries out detail record.
2 mensuration projects
The weight of all pigs before test starting weight=on-test
Average starting weight=test starting weight/test pig's head number
The weight of all pigs when testing end weight=off-test
Average end weight=test end weight/test pig's head number
Average daily weightening finish=duration of test total augment weight/(the test pig's head is counted * test fate)
The total augment weight of the total feed consumption rate/duration of test piggy of feedstuff-meat ratio=duration of test
The dead number of the death rate=duration of test pig/test pig's head number
3 result of the tests
Can be known by table 3, use auxin after 41 days, the test group piglet is than the control group 2.62 kg/ heads that increased weight more, and average daily feed intake has increased by 19 g/ previous day, daily increased by 57 g/ previous day, and feedstuff-meat ratio has descended 0.20.
This result of the test shows that the average last anharmonic ratio control group of test group piglet has increased by 2.62 kg/ heads.The average daily weightening finish of test group has increased by 57 g/ heads than control group. day, average daily feed intake has increased by 19 g/ heads. day, feedstuff-meat ratio has descended 0.20; This is because " auxin " has the food calling effect; Promote stomach and intestine rhythm and pace of moving things wriggling, strengthen piglet digestion and absorption, effectively improve the piglet feed intake; On the other hand, auxin also has the amino acid whose absorption of metabolism in the nutrition of the enteron aisle of stimulation synthetic diet, and protein synthesizes and reduce the oxidation of protein in the increase feed nutrition, can also strengthen the utilization of body fat, thereby improves the utilization rate of feed.
